Preferred Label : Thromboelastography;

Alternative definition : CDISC: A method of testing the efficiency of blood coagulation in which the amplitude of movement of a pin suspended in the center of an oscillating blood sample, or the vertical movement of the meniscus of a vibrating blood sample, is measured over time and analyzed to assess the dynamics and physical properties of blood clot formation in a low shear environment.;
